Yes! What you are holding in your hands is the right book. It is an easy to read, user-friendly book that helps the reader understand breast cancer risks and how to minimize the risks and possibly prevent breast cancer from occuring in an individual person. The book provides diagrams, tables, and full-color images that are easy-to-follow. These are helpful in illustrating some points and concepts in various chapters of the book. Chapter summaries give overviews of important points . These are helpful in reinforcing understanding and retention of the matrial information gleaned from the book.
